To travel to Brunei from Sabah you have to cross the border either sungai tujuh, sarawak or icqs megkalap (choice is yours)
Make sure you have a valid international driving license & the car rental allows you to cross the border because sometimes the car rentals simply won’t allow or they don’t have permission.
Checkout these two things before planning your travel by road, apart from your multiple entry visa.
